Anker Schiffahrt signs contract extension with UPM-Kymmene


Anker Schiffahrts-Gesellschaft mbH and UPM-Kymmene Oyj, a Finnish company in the bio and forest industry, have extended the contract for handling forest products. 

Anker Schiffahrt will primarily handle pulp for UPM-Kymmene at the Emskai “for several years” and deliver it to both national and international customers and the UPM Nordland Papier GmbH mill in Dörpen.

Additionally, Anker Schiffahrt will act as shipbroker for all pulp imports, as well as stevedore on board and on land. In addition, the company is to partly arrange on-carriage by barge, rail and truck as well as container stuffing.

Anker Schiffahrt is the operator of a modern multi-purpose seaport terminal in the outer port of Emden. It won this contract again “against tough national and international competition”, it said in a statement. 

By signing the contract, the two companies are continuing their cooperation, which has been in existence since 1983.
